Product details

Overview

BQ2023PWG4 from Texas Instruments is a multifunction battery monitoring IC designed for single-cell Li-ion/Li-polymer battery packs. It performs high-accuracy coulomb counting via differential current sensing (SRP/SRN), integrates an internal temperature sensor with 0.25°K resolution, and communicates over a single-wire SDQ interface. It delivers state-of-charge information to host controllers in portable electronics such as cellular phones and PDAs.

Technical Context

The BQ2023PWG4 implements a voltage-to-frequency converter (VFC) architecture to digitize differential sense voltage (±100 mV range) into charge/discharge counts at 3.05 µVh/LSB resolution. Its internal timebase eliminates external crystal requirements, and continuous auto-calibration compensates VFC offset drift hourly.

It operates on a Dallas Semiconductor–compatible 1-wire SDQ bus, supporting multi-device nodes with CRC-protected command framing. The device uses register-based control via ROM and memory function commands, with dedicated counters (DCR/CCR/SCR) and timers (DTC/CTC) mapped across a 271-byte address space spanning flash, RAM, and secure ID ROM.

Key Specifications

ParameterValue and Actual Design Meaning
Supply Voltage Range2.4 V to 5.0 V - supports operation down to single-cell Li-ion minimum voltage without brownout
Current Sensing Resolution3.05 µVh/LSB - enables sub-milliamp-hour accuracy in coulomb counting over extended runtime
VFC Input Range±100 mV differential - accommodates typical 0.02 Ω sense resistors at ±5 A full-scale current
Temperature Sensing0.25°K resolution, ±4°K accuracy - replaces external thermistors in battery pack designs
Memory Resources224 bytes flash (7 × 32-byte pages), 32 bytes RAM, 8-byte secure ID ROM - stores calibrated gas-gauge parameters and pack identity
Quiescent Current40 µA operating / 1.5 µA sleep - extends shelf life and minimizes self-discharge impact during storage
Interface ProtocolSDQ single-wire serial (1-wire compatible) with CRC-protected read/write - reduces PCB routing complexity and connector pin count

Pinout & Package

Package: 8-pin TSSOP (PW), 3.0 mm × 4.4 mm, 0.65 mm pitch, moisture sensitivity level 3.

Pin/TerminalCircuit RoleDesign Meaning
RBIRegister Backup I/OProvides backup power path to retain RAM/register contents when VCC drops below POR threshold (2.34 V)
VCCSupply InputPrimary power input (2.4–5.0 V); powers analog/digital blocks and enables flash write/erase operations above 2.8 V
VSSGround ReferenceAnalog/digital common return; serves as reference for SRP/SRN differential sensing and internal ADC
SDQSingle-Wire Data I/OBidirectional 1-wire interface with pullup; handles all command, data, and CRC exchange with host controller
STATOpen-Drain Status OutputAsserts low to signal fault or status events; disabled in sleep mode when PDET is low
SRPCurrent Sense Positive InputConnects to battery negative terminal side of sense resistor; polarity determines charge/discharge direction
SRNCurrent Sense Negative InputConnects to pack negative contact side of sense resistor; differential voltage (SRP–SRN) drives VFC
PDETPack Removal Detection InputActive-low input that forces immediate sleep mode and disables STAT output upon battery pack disconnection

Key Features

FeatureDesign Value
Differential Current SensingEliminates common-mode noise and ground loop errors in high-side or low-side sense configurations
Auto-Offset CalibrationPerforms hourly VFC offset compensation without host intervention, maintaining long-term measurement stability
Integrated Temperature SensorEnables real-time thermal correction of capacity estimation without adding external components or layout area
Low-Power Sleep ModeReduces system standby current to 1.5 µA while preserving temperature and self-discharge registers
Secure ID ROM64-bit factory-programmable serialization with CRC ensures pack authenticity and prevents counterfeit substitution

FAQ

What is the minimum operating voltage for the BQ2023PWG4?

The BQ2023PWG4 operates down to 2.4 V, enabling reliable functionality across the full discharge curve of single-cell Li-ion and Li-polymer batteries. Below 2.4 V, the device enters sleep mode unless flash programming is active - which requires ≥2.8 V. This low-voltage capability ensures continuous state-of-charge reporting even under deep discharge conditions before protection circuitry triggers.

How does the BQ2023PWG4 achieve high-accuracy current measurement without external calibration?

The BQ2023PWG4 achieves high-accuracy current measurement through an internal voltage-to-frequency converter (VFC) with automatic hourly offset calibration and continuous compensation. Its VFC resolves signals down to 3.05 µVh, and the auto-compensation corrects for drift caused by temperature and aging - eliminating the need for manual calibration or external trimming components in production.

Can the BQ2023PWG4 operate without an external crystal oscillator?

Yes, the BQ2023PWG4 includes a high-accuracy internal timebase that eliminates the need for an external crystal oscillator. This integrated timing source supports all coulomb counting, timer functions (DTC/CTC), and SDQ communication timing - reducing bill-of-materials cost, PCB area, and design complexity while maintaining ±4% timer accuracy over –20°C to 70°C.

What is the role of the PDET pin on the BQ2023PWG4?

The PDET pin on the BQ2023PWG4 is an active-low pack removal detection input. When pulled low, it immediately places the BQ2023PWG4 into sleep mode and disables the open-drain STAT output - preventing false status signals and minimizing current draw when the battery pack is disconnected from the host system. This feature enhances safety and power efficiency in hot-swap battery applications.

Does the BQ2023PWG4 support multiple devices on the same SDQ bus?

Yes, the BQ2023PWG4 supports multiple devices on the same SDQ bus using Dallas Semiconductor–compatible 1-wire protocol. Each device has a unique 64-bit ID ROM, enabling individual addressing via Match ROM or Search ROM commands. This allows daisy-chained or parallel topologies in multi-cell or multi-pack systems without additional hardware arbitration.
